Advanced Techniques in Preservation and Digital Documentation

The modern approach to conservation leverages technology for digitally capturing and analyzing stone relief carvings. High-resolution 3D scanning, photogrammetry, and multispectral imaging enable accurate records that help conservators assess deterioration, plan restoration, and facilitate scholarly research. For instance, advanced 3D models allow for virtual reconstructions of damaged reliefs, making cultural narratives accessible without risking further physical harm.

Case Study: Restoration of the Luxor Temple Reliefs

The Luxor Temple in Egypt showcases extensive relief carvings that reveal the religious and political ideologies of pharaonic Egypt. Over centuries, seismic activity, pollution, and human interaction caused significant deterioration. A comprehensive conservation project incorporated:

  • Laser cleaning techniques to remove encrustations
  • 3D mapping to document original relief details
  • Use of compatible new materials for structural stabilization

This multidisciplinary approach exemplifies how combining traditional craftsmanship with cutting-edge technology can restore clarity and safeguard such irreplaceable artworks.

Emerging Industry Insights and Future Directions

Looking ahead, the intersection of heritage science, AI-driven analysis, and community engagement promises to redefine how we interpret and preserve stone relief carvings. Notably:

  1. AI-Assisted Pattern Recognition: Automated systems can identify motifs, stylistic variants, and wear patterns at unprecedented scales.
  2. Community-Centered Conservation: Digital platforms facilitate public participation, broadening understanding and fostering shared responsibility.
  3. Sustainable Preservation Practices: Emphasizing minimally invasive techniques and local materials reduces ecological footprints of restoration efforts.
